Strategic Applications for Brand Identity and Design

One of the strongest aspects of Teacher Icons is its adaptability across various design mediums. While primarily designed for digital use, the clarity of the lines makes them suitable for printable design applications as well. I envision these working effectively on packaging inserts for educational kits, stickers for student rewards, or even as accents on product labels for handmade teaching supplies. The key is maintaining scale and ensuring the details remain crisp when printed.

For web design and editorial layouts, these illustrations serve as excellent breakers between text-heavy sections. They prevent reader fatigue and keep the user engaged with the content. When building Canva templates for clients, having a set of cohesive icons allows for rapid content creation without sacrificing quality. This efficiency is a major selling point for content creators and social media managers who need to produce high volumes of marketing visuals under tight deadlines.

However, it is important to note where this asset should be used carefully. Teacher Icons leans towards a friendly, illustrative style. Therefore, it may not be the best fit for formal corporate branding that requires strict minimalism or high-end luxury aesthetics. In dense information layouts or text-heavy ads, the illustrations might distract from the core message if not spaced correctly. Additionally, on low-contrast backgrounds, the softer color palette might lose visibility. Designers must test these icons against their specific brand color palette to ensure readability and impact.
